I thought the Sailor Moon theme for their drinks was cool to see, and was looking forward to checking out Justeas. Unfortunately, this was one of the worst milk teas I've had in a really long time. I rarely give a 1 star review, but it was difficult to justify anything higher. I stopped by over the weekend since I was in the area. Their hours aren't posted on Yelp, but they were already open by 11am on the weekend. They are located at the back of the Shell gas station on the corner of Sunnyvale-Saratoga and Fremont Avenue. Look for the Longhorn Restaurant sign, their boba banner, and cute orange-ish colored trailer.Their drinks do not come with any toppings, and toppings are an additional $0.50 each. There are 4 toppings to choose from: honey boba, rainbow jelly, strawberry popping boba, mango popping boba. Delivery is available through GrubHub, DoorDash and Uber Eats.I decided to try the Phantom (Coffee Milk Tea, $5.20, https://www.yelp.com/user_local_photos?select=OmrIjcwmY-50iSU2XGo-wg&userid=76vIFZcC7owykCBjMfGVXg), at 25% sweet and 25% ice. As you can see from the photo, the drink was barely 3/4 full, and it was filled with 75% ice (despite ordering 25% ice). What's worse was that the drink was barely drinkable- there was no milk or tea flavor, and the only thing I could taste was the extreme bitterness from the burnt coffee. There was also no sweetness whatsoever to the drink. I'm someone who almost never wastes food or drinks, and I wanted to toss this out after the first sip.I sincerely hope this was an off day, and that they do more quality control before serving drinks to their customers. However, it was really nice to see their staff was still wearing a mask, and they had hand sanitizer. Both cash and credit cards are accepted. No seating was available. Parking should be easy to find- I would recommend you park in the plaza behind where the trailer is parked since there are a lot more spots there.

Justeas is a boba cart/trailer in the Fremont Corners Center on the side of the Shell gas station. They seem to have a Sailor Moon theme going on as well, which was interesting. Their hours are a bit weird, they are always closed in the evenings when I drive by, so I decided to check them out when I was in the area on an afternoon.I wanted a jasmine milk tea with boba, but it was not on the menu. I asked the employee if they have something similar and she made me some sort of green milk tea, so that was nice of her (hence the 2 stars instead of 1 star). The milk tea was not the best, it was a bit too creamy and sugary tasting with barely any tea taste to it, and the boba was way too soft and soggy.

This cute little tea cart is parked up at a shell gas station right across from Fremont high school. I drive by a lot and always wonder if it's any good. One day I was craving boba and remembered this spot right as I pulled up to the light. Figured I'd give it a try. Plus their logo is based of Luna from sailor moon! Super kawaii.The person working was nice and let me take my time ordering. I ended up getting their Iced horchata milk tea at %75 sweetness with honey boba. Was made quickly and in my hand minutes after ordering! Now let me just say the horchata tasted amazing, sweet but not overbearing. However, their boba was just not what I'm used to. Taste was off and texture was not there. Not saying their wrong but it's just not what I like. Texture was more on the jello-ie side vs traditional tapioca being a bit starchy. ( if that makes any sense ) Definitely say it's worth a try but don't expect the boba to be your favorite. Maybe try their other add ons!
